Nowadays, young people have a wide range of possibilities: travelling, working or chilling out, internships, an FSJ or FÖJ, an apprenticeship or study. The big question is only what and in what order.Finding the right thing is incredibly difficult for many people. Because information and knowledge alone do not create orientation. Some people get lost in this sea of possibilities. This can lead to pressure to perform, fear of the future and blockades.To make matters worse, digitisation and globalisation are radically changing the world of work and life. As a result, today's professional biographies differ fundamentally from those of the past.

Especially the transition from school to the new phase of life represents a threshold situation within the family.
The ambivalence of autonomy and adaptation, of detachment and attachment can trigger contradictory emotions in all family members and cause excessive demands.In this situation we offer help and support.
Our study & career counselling is not only there to provide orientation for the right choice of study, training or career, but also to avoid paralysis, self-doubt, family conflicts or depression, change of subject or dropping out.
